The renovations at 57 Gibson, Focus House, by the Bridge Church and The Bridge 320 Ministry will redefine the space to focus on Spiritual/Mental health needs. This means new recovery rooms for people entering into the Bridge 320 care, renovated space for the live in Ministry Leaders, and new opportunities for ways to bring spiritual guidance and healing.
The Pastor and Director, Randy Roser, said “Spiritual/Mental Health issues are increasing in the Carson City area and the resources to address it should too.”
Carson City has services which keep people safe and from freezing to death. But, the homeless population has changed over the years. Carson City now has Spiritual/Mental health issues and there needs to be revisions in the city wide systems, if something is going to change.
“Bridge 320 will be the place where hurting people can receive a relationship with Jesus Christ and through the Holy Spirit, acquire the tools to change their life,” Randy Roser said. “We meet the people’s needs spiritually, mentally, physically and emotionally.”
The renovation of the Focus House will cost roughly forty thousand dollars. With the project scheduled to be finished by the end of May, 2024.
The F.I.S.H. emergency shelters are staying open and will be moved into other F.I.S.H run homes.
